Holzhauser Bruch Weather by Month: Complete Twelve-Month Climate Comparison

Examine the complete twelve-month climate record for Holzhauser Bruch to track long-term shifts in average minimum, mean, and maximum temperatures alongside daily precipitation rates. Comparing these baseline monthly normals across humidity, wind speed, and calculated daylight hours reveals the full annual environmental cycle at a representative coordinate.
Mean temperaturePrecipitationHumidityWind speedDaylight
January0.5 °C-10° to 9.4°2.5 mm/day93.1%5.7 m/s8.1 hours
February1.3 °C-8.5° to 11°2 mm/day90.3%5.5 m/s9.6 hours
March4.4 °C-4.9° to 16.2°2 mm/day85.4%5.1 m/s11.6 hours
April8.6 °C-2.5° to 21.2°1.6 mm/day79.4%4.3 m/s13.7 hours
May12.8 °C1.5° to 24.9°2 mm/day77.7%4.1 m/s15.5 hours
June15.9 °C5.8° to 28.1°2.3 mm/day77.1%4 m/s16.4 hours
July18.1 °C8.5° to 29.8°2.5 mm/day75.7%3.9 m/s16 hours
August17.9 °C8.2° to 30.4°2.4 mm/day75%3.9 m/s14.4 hours
September14.2 °C5.4° to 25.8°2.1 mm/day78.4%4.2 m/s12.3 hours
October9.4 °C-0.6° to 20.8°2.2 mm/day85.5%4.8 m/s10.3 hours
November4.8 °C-3.5° to 14.3°2.4 mm/day92.2%4.9 m/s8.5 hours
December1.5 °C-7.4° to 10.2°2.6 mm/day93.8%5.4 m/s7.6 hours

Examine the Mapped Geography and Protected Landscapes of Holzhauser Bruch

Access a structured view of Holzhauser Bruch, a nature reserve nestled in the Werre valley of Nordrhein-Westfalen. MoriAtlas provides a clear look at its riparian corridors, wetland mosaics, and the distinct transition between bog lowlands and sandy upland forests for comprehensive geographic discovery.
